Competition Electronics ProChrono DLX with Bluetooth Review

Let’s Talk About Competition Electronics ProChrono DLX with Bluetooth

The Competition Electronics ProChrono DLX with Bluetooth is a modern chronograph designed to measure the velocity of projectiles. This includes everything from bullets and shotgun slugs to arrows and paintballs. Competition Electronics has been refining this design since 1985, and the DLX model brings the classic ProChrono into the age of smartphones and data logging. It’s a tool that reloaders, archers, and airgun enthusiasts can use to fine-tune their setups and analyze their performance.

Breaking Down the Features of Competition Electronics ProChrono DLX with Bluetooth

Specifications

The Competition Electronics ProChrono DLX with Bluetooth boasts several key specifications:

  • Velocity Range: Measures velocities from 20 to 9,999 feet per second. This range covers virtually all common firearms, airguns, and archery setups.
  • Size: Compact dimensions of 16x4x3-1/4 inches make it easy to transport and store.
  • Accuracy: An impressive +/-.5% of measured velocity or better ensures reliable readings.
  • Memory Capacity: Stores up to 9 strings of up to 99 shots each, allowing for extensive data collection.
  • Bluetooth: Features both BT2 and BT4LE for compatibility with a wide range of devices.
  • Power: Requires one 9 volt alkaline battery, providing 20+ hours of operation.
  • Manufacturer: Competition Electronics.

These specifications translate to practical benefits. The wide velocity range makes it versatile for different shooting disciplines. The high accuracy is crucial for precise load development. The Bluetooth connectivity streamlines data logging and analysis.

Accessories and Customization Options

The ProChrono DLX comes with the following accessories:

  • Sunshades: Essential for accurate readings in bright sunlight.
  • Guide Wires: Help align the chronograph with the target.

Competition Electronics also offers an optional Indoor Lighting System (part# CEI-4100) for indoor use. This is a worthwhile addition for shooters who want to use the ProChrono DLX in indoor ranges.

Pros and Cons of Competition Electronics ProChrono DLX with Bluetooth

Pros

  • Accurate and reliable velocity measurements. Provides consistent readings for precise load development.
  • Bluetooth connectivity and mobile app integration. Simplifies data logging and analysis.
  • Easy to set up and use. Minimizes time spent fiddling with equipment.
  • Versatile for various shooting disciplines. Compatible with firearms, airguns, and archery setups.
  • Durable construction. Withstands regular use at the range.

Cons

  • Requires a 9V battery (not included). Can be an inconvenience if forgotten.
  • Sunshade assembly can be a bit fiddly. Requires some patience to set up properly.
